Output 622e820f316daa18122fe14d23578c35382582889ad72384700f8f7c12a2bcb6:0

value
723323
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b9fc07167f88865fe65bd2bae99c0c2eb6a731e OP_EQUALVERIFY OP_CHECKSIG
address
16SGF4eKRHPqMUEFfVpiWPRafbLho9X5pd
transaction
622e820f316daa18122fe14d23578c35382582889ad72384700f8f7c12a2bcb6
confirmations
288537
spent
true